Spring Events at Umoja Garden
By The Changeling | April 24, 2008
Learning Garden programs bring garden-based learning to New York City schoolchildren and community members.
Learning Gardens “Coming UP†Inauguration - Friday, April 25th 11:00 a.m. - 3:30 p.m.
Celebrate this new community green haven and help the greening of Brooklyn by planting a tree, a seed, a flower, and a dream.
It’s My Garden (Oops! My Park) - Saturday, May 17th 12:00 - 3:00 p.m.
Grow your gardening skills and heighten your senses as we plant, play, and prance together.
Butterflies ‘n’ Buds - Saturday, June 21st 12:00 - 3:00 p.m.
Greet the butterflies and help create a splendid habitat by planting bold and bodacious flowers.
Learning in the Garden - July 7th to August 14th 10:00 a.m. - 3:00 p.m.
Classes and activities for community groups, day camps, organizations, and other programs are offered from July 8th-August 14th. Call (212) 360-1485 to schedule classes.
Plant ‘n’ Play - Wednesdays (July 9th, 16th, 23rd, 30th; August 6th, 13th) 4:00 p.m. - 7:00 p.m.
Plant flowers, dig in the soil, and harvest yummy fruits and veggies. Games and activities for people of all ages.
Plant & Play Time - Saturdays (July 12th, 19th, 26th; August 2nd, 9th, 16th) 12:00 p.m. - 3:00 p.m.
Plant flowers, dig in the soil, and harvest yummy fruits and veggies. Games and activities for people of all ages.
Tasty Harvest - Saturday, September 20th 12:00 p.m. - 3:00 p.m.
Savor the bountiful flavors of the garden at summer’s end.
Umoja Garden
Broadway and Putnam Avenue
